The menu of Ivan Ramen from New York comprises about 128 different menus and drinks. On average you pay about $8.8 for a dish / drink.
The reviews for this restaurant are mixed, with some customers experiencing rushed service and average food quality, while others rave about the delicious ramen and appetizers. The servers were criticized for trying to rush customers out and not providing attentive service, but the ramen dishes were praised for their rich flavor and high quality ingredients. Some diners found the portion sizes to be small, while others enjoyed the cozy atmosphere and friendly staff. Overall, the restaurant seems to have its strengths and weaknesses, with some recommending it for a unique ramen experience and inventive appetizers, while others suggest it may not be worth a visit.
